Ważność linków do płatności

Ważność danego linku zależy od ustawień Sprzedawcy. Standardowo linki do płatności, nie posiadają ograniczenia czasowego. Jeśli linki są generowane za pomocą budowania odnośników, to czas może zostać ustawiony w trakcie jego tworzenia. 

Aby wygenerować link z ograniczeniem czasowym, wystarczy dodać na końcu parametr expiration_date = RRRR:MM:DD:HH:MM (dla strefy czasowej GMT+1 (Warsaw Poland))
Jak chcemy mieć pewność, że klient sobie sam nie przestawi tej daty w parametrze, to należy dodać timehash , który oblicza się następująco: timehash=md5(expiration_date + kod bezpieczeństwa)

Przykład wygenerowania transakcji z datą ważności przez link:
https://secure.tpay.com/?id=1010&kwota=20&opis=test&timehash=024bb97b79bc0ce3f8a591b018b5a58e&expiration_date=2018:07:03:16:13&md5sum=118586863878d93bc88e777cf24e239f

Ważne!
Jeśli ktoś zapłaci w czasie, kiedy link jest ważny, to nawet jak transakcja zostanie zaksięgowana później, to i tak otrzyma status poprawnej. Jeśli ktoś chce automatycznie zwracać takie transakcje, to musi skorzystać z dwuetapowego przyjmowania płatności.

Czy odpowiedź była przydatna?
 0
 0